Pro Se Engine

A powerful MCP (Model Context Protocol) server providing 39 legal research tools across 6 government APIs — designed for use with Pickaxe AI agents.

Built by ProjectCues.


🏛️ What It Does

Pro Se Engine gives AI agents access to:

Tool Categories

  • Case Law — Search opinions, read full text, verify citations

  • SEC Filings — Full-text search, company filings, XBRL financials

  • Federal Legislation — Bills, bill text, Congress members

  • Regulations — Federal Register rules, regulatory dockets, public comments

  • Government Contracts — USAspending awards, contractor profiles

  • Documents — Generate DOCX, extract text from PDF/DOCX, tracked changes editing

  • Workflows — 13 structured legal analysis templates (M&A due diligence, lease abstracts, litigation assessment, etc.)

🚀 Quick Start

1. Install dependencies

npm install

2. Configure environment

cp .env.example .env
# Edit .env with your API keys

3. Run in development

npm run dev

4. Build for production

npm run build
node dist/index.js

The server starts on http://localhost:3001/mcp.

🔗 Connecting to Pickaxe

  1. Deploy this server to a public URL (e.g., Hostinger VPS)

  2. In Pickaxe Agent Builder, add an MCP server

  3. Set the endpoint URL to https://your-domain.com/mcp

  4. If MCP_AUTH_TOKEN is set, configure the bearer token in Pickaxe

🏗️ Architecture

  • Runtime: Node.js 20+

  • Language: TypeScript (strict mode)

  • Transport: Streamable HTTP (stateless — each request is independent)

  • Framework: Express + @modelcontextprotocol/sdk
